一种域控制器软件刷写方法、装置、系统及存储介质制造方法及图纸

技术编号:42582796 阅读:25 留言:0更新日期:2024-09-03 18:01
本发明专利技术涉及车辆技术领域,公开了一种域控制器软件刷写方法、装置、系统及存储介质,方法应用于刷写设备,刷写设备与域控制器通信连接,方法包括:接收若干待刷写软件包;启动统一刷写程序,统一刷写程序中封装了对域控制器中各个芯片进行软件刷写的刷写方法;通过统一刷写程序识别各个待刷写软件包对应的芯片;通过统一刷写程序执行各个芯片对应的刷写方法,以将对应的待刷写软件包刷写到域控制器中对应的芯片。本发明专利技术解决了域控制器芯片软件升级效率低、性能差的问题。

【技术实现步骤摘要】

本专利技术涉及车辆,具体涉及一种域控制器软件刷写方法、装置、系统及存储介质


技术介绍

1、随着智能汽车行业的发展,为了满足自动驾驶业务的需要,自动驾驶中央域控制器的设计发展越来越快,中央域控制器由传统的同一类型单个芯片到不同类型多个芯片演变,例如域控制器中可以包括soc芯片、mcu芯片、switch芯片等,由于不同芯片架构不同,相关技术往往采用不同的刷写设备对不同芯片进行软件刷写,从而为不同芯片升级软件,这使得传统的自动驾驶中央域控制器刷写方式效率低,无法满足业务的需要。而一些技术为了解决这一问题在每个芯片中部署升级模块,或者在部分芯片中部署升级模块,然后把升级包发送给芯片,让芯片通过升级模块自主解析软件包对自身进行升级,但是这种方法的软件部署成本高,且每个芯片还需要部署升级模块,令本不多的芯片存储空间产生更多占用,不利于维护芯片的性能。


技术实现思路

1、有鉴于此,本专利技术提供了一种域控制器软件刷写方法、装置、系统及存储介质,以解决域控制器芯片软件升级效率低、性能差的问题。

<p>2、第一方面,本本文档来自技高网...

【技术保护点】

1.一种域控制器软件刷写方法,其特征在于,应用于刷写设备,所述刷写设备与所述域控制器通信连接,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述统一刷写程序中包括统一刷写接口,所述统一刷写接口封装了分别用于对不同芯片刷写的原生刷写接口,每个原生刷写接口用于执行对应芯片的刷写方法。

3.根据权利要求2所述的方法,其特征在于,所述通过所述统一刷写程序识别各个待刷写软件包对应的芯片,包括:

4.根据权利要求1或3所述的方法,其特征在于,在所述通过所述统一刷写程序执行各个芯片对应的刷写方法之前,所述方法还包括:

5.根据权利要求4所述的...

【技术特征摘要】

1.一种域控制器软件刷写方法,其特征在于,应用于刷写设备,所述刷写设备与所述域控制器通信连接,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述统一刷写程序中包括统一刷写接口,所述统一刷写接口封装了分别用于对不同芯片刷写的原生刷写接口,每个原生刷写接口用于执行对应芯片的刷写方法。

3.根据权利要求2所述的方法,其特征在于,所述通过所述统一刷写程序识别各个待刷写软件包对应的芯片,包括:

4.根据权利要求1或3所述的方法,其特征在于,在所述通过所述统一刷写程序执行各个芯片对应的刷写方法之前,所述方法还包括:

5.根据权利要求4所述的方法,其特征在于,当所述刷写标志是同步刷写时,所述通过所述统一刷写程序执行各个芯片对应的刷写方法,包括:

6.根据权利要求5所述的方法,其特征在于,所述方法还包括:

7.根据权利要求4所述的方法,其特征在于,当所述刷写标志是异步刷写...

【专利技术属性】
技术研发人员:何珍林杨明灯
申请(专利权)人:重庆长安科技有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1